Title:
METHOD FOR MEASURING LENS DISPLACEMENT QUANTITY OF ORIGINAL DISK EXPOSING MACHINE
Document Type and Number:
Japanese Patent JPH0328811
Kind Code:
A
Abstract:
PURPOSE:To measure the quantity of displacement of an objective in the direction of the rotary surface of an original disk by detecting the phase difference of the displacement quantity output of an actuator. CONSTITUTION:Displacement detection sensors 7 and 8 detect variation in the displacement quantity of the actuator 4 in a direction intersecting orthogonally with the rotary surface of the original disk 1. Further, the voltage conversion waveform of the displacement at this time is viewed to judge that the displacement quantity of a lens supporting body 2 along the rotary surface of the original disk 1 is zero on condition that a waveform A detected by the sensor 7 conforms with a waveform B detected by the sensor 8. At this time, the lens supporting body 2 is held by a leaf spring slightly slanting from its vertical attitude. Consequently, the objective 3 is displaced along the rotary surface of the original disk 1, but this state generates the waveform A detected by the sensor 7 and the waveform B detected by the sensor 8 to have a phase difference DELTAPHI, which is detected. Consequently the displacement quantity of the objective 3 can be measured.
